From Base64 to Pixels: A Visual Transformation

Base64 representation is a technique for repurposing binary data into a printable ASCII string. While it may seem like an obscure system, Base64 often plays a crucial role in delivering visual content online. This is because many web browsers and applications utilize Base64 to integrate images, icons, and other visual assets directly into HTML code.

The transformation click from Base64 string to visible pixels involves a few key steps. First, the Base64 encoded string is unpacked back into its original binary format. This raw binary data then holds the image information, including color palettes, pixel configurations, and other relevant specifications. Finally, a graphics library interprets this binary data and displays the corresponding image on your screen.

This seemingly simple process allows for efficient sharing of visual content over the web, improving the overall user experience.

Decoding Base64 to Images: A Simple Tutorial

Unveiling the mysteries of Base64 encoding and its connection to images can feel like deciphering a secret code. Yet, with a few techniques at your disposal, you can effortlessly convert Base64-encoded strings into displayed images. This guide will walk you through the process step by step, providing clear explanations and practical examples to illuminate this fascinating realm.

First, understand that Base64 is a method for encoding binary data into a text-based format. This allows to represent images and other non-textual data as strings of characters that can be easily transmitted or stored. To convert a Base64 string into an image, you'll need to use a tool or script that understands this encoding scheme. Various online converters are available, or you can implement the conversion yourself using programming languages like Python.

  • Investigate various online Base64 to image converters for a user-friendly approach.
  • Utilize libraries in programming platforms like Python for more control and customization.
  • Remember that the output format of the converted image will depend on the specific converter or script used.
